UFC 249: ‘Jacare’ Souza tests positive for coronavirus; out of fight against Uriah Hall
- Souza and two of his cornerman test positive for Covid-19 after arriving in Florida on Friday
- ‘Jacare’ weighed in for Saturday’s fight wearing mask and gloves, and kept distance from opponent Uriah Hall

The UFC 249 card scheduled for Saturday in Florida will go ahead as planned despite one of the undercard fighters testing positive for coronavirus.
Ronaldo “Jacare” Souza was dropped from the Jacksonville event after he was diagnosed with Covid-19 on Friday. He arrived in Florida earlier in the week.
Two of Souza’s cornermen also tested positive.

“UFC’s medical team examined Souza and his two cornermen and found them to be currently asymptomatic, or not exhibiting the common symptoms of Covid-19,” organisers said in a statement late Friday night.
“All three men have left the host hotel and will be self-isolating off premises.”
